Niners hold off Rams' surge to seal first-round bye
ST. LOUIS -- No apologies from Jim Harbaugh. Not even close. After the San Francisco 49ers had to make stops late to hold off the suddenly spunky St. Louis Rams in their regular-season finale, their first-year coach was clear he definitely did not have mixed emotions. "I feel great," Harbaugh said

Rams DE Hall got forearm on Browns' missed field-goal attempt
St. Louis Rams coach Steve Spagnuolo said game tape showed defensive end James Hall getting a piece of Cleveland's blown field goal near the end of the Rams' 13-12 victory over the Cleveland Browns Sunday.

Head injuries aren't serious for Rams' Smith, Scott
Rams right tackle Jason Smith and defensive tackle Darell Scott were expected to fly back to St. Louis with the team after they were taken to the hospital because of head injuries sustained against the Cowboys.

Bucs call on 'Insurance' Graham to spark the run vs. Bears
Tampa Bay Buccaneers running back LeGarrette Blount has yet to practice with the Bucs in London this week, meaning 31-year-old Earnest Graham is likely to again be called upon to carry the running game in the fifth edition of the NFL's annual regular-season game in the British capital.

Ravens rookie WR Smith triggers record-setting win over Rams
Torrey Smith caught long touchdown passes from Joe Flacco totaling 133 yards on his first three career receptions, a huge first half that sparked a franchise record-setting day on offense by the Baltimore Ravens in a 37-7 rout of the defenseless St. Louis Rams on Sunday.
